Retrospective Study of Implants installed by Osteotome Technique

Abstract


When the quantity and quality of bone at maxillary edentulous area are inadequate for installation of implant, we can use osteotome technique as more conservative procedure among surgical method to overcome the limitation. It has several advantages, for example, simple procedure more than lateral approach to maxillary sinus, short healing period, and prevention of bone loss by excessive drilling or accidental perforation of maxillary sinus, and so on. Also we can use osteotome technique as trabecular impaction at maxillary posterior area which quality of bone is poor, or as ridge expansion osteotomy at bucco-lingually narrow alveolar crest. The purpose of this study are to reveal clinical usefulness of osteotome technique, and to report about various factors influence long-term success rate by observation and analysis of course of 142 implants installed to 58 patients by osteotome technique in Seoul National University Bundang Hospital from June, 2003 to December, 2004.
